The Indiana Pacers announced Monday they have signed Julyan Stone and Alex Poythress. Stone is a 6-6 guard that is a three-year veteran of the NBA, spending time with both the Denver Nuggets and the Toronto Raptors. He has NBA career averages of 1.3 points and 1.1 assists per game. He has also spent time in the NBA Developmental League, playing for both the Idaho Stampede and Iowa Energy. His averages for his time in the D-League are 4.7 points and 4.3 assists. He played collegiately at the University of Texas at El Paso (UTEP).
Rookie Vince Hunter has also agreed to join the Bighorns. The 6-foot-8, 208-pound forward averaged 14.9 points and 9.2 rebounds per game as a sophomore at UTEP, but he went unselected in the NBA Draft in June. He spent training camp with the Kings in October, playing a total of two minutes.
